NEWMAN, Circuit Judge:

This appeal concerns a somewhat bizarre attempt to obtain damages under the antitrust laws. Reading Industries, Inc. (Reading) alleges that a conspiracy to keep prices low caused it, through a series of complex market interactions, to pay prices that were unduly high.
